The results of the 2024 Compendium survey are now live on the Compendium data website following the “Data Release Infoshare” which took place on 25 February 2025. For the first time all the responses to all 90+ Compendium survey questions are accessible and downloadable, just a few months after the survey closed.

To help decision makers form an accurate picture of the European NREN community, it is essential to provide up to date information in a timely manner, hence the quick turn-around from closing the 2024 survey, to publishing the results online. And to raise awareness of the breadth of subjects covered by the Compendium, an individual page has been created for each question.

What is the Compendium?

Every year GÉANT invites NRENs to fill in a questionnaire asking about their network, their organisation, standards and policies, connected users, and the services they offer their users. All the responses received – together with other surveys and studies carried out within different teams within GÉANT and the NREN community – make the Compendium Report, an authoritative reference source for anyone with an interest in the development of research and education networking in Europe and beyond.

Last year, a new Compendium website was launched. On the new website you can download the Compendium Report as well as browse through the Compendium Data in the form of customisable graphs, charts, and tables to quickly identify developments and trends: compendium.geant.org.
